在软件开发的过程中,使用GitHub作为版本控制和协作的平台是非常常见的。然而,有时我们可能需要退出某个项目,无论是由于时间管理、项目方向改变,还是其他个人原因。在本文中,我们将深入探讨如何在GitHub上退出项目的步骤以及相关注意事项,并解答一些常见问题。
一、什么是GitHub项目?
GitHub项目是一个用于协作开发、版本控制的存储库,它可以包含代码、文档以及其他资源。项目的管理通常依赖于分支、合并请求(PR)、问题追踪(Issues)等功能。无论是开源项目还是私有项目,GitHub都提供了便利的工具来帮助开发者高效工作。
二、为什么选择退出GitHub项目?
1. 时间管理
- 当个人的时间安排发生变化时,可能无法继续参与项目。
2. 项目方向变化
- 项目的目标或方向可能与个人的职业目标不再一致。
3. 个人原因
- 包括健康问题、家庭责任等,可能迫使开发者退出。
三、退出GitHub项目的步骤
退出GitHub项目的过程相对简单,以下是具体步骤:
1. 确认你的决定
在退出之前,确保你已做出明智的决定,并考虑清楚原因。
2. 通知项目负责人
- 最好提前告知项目负责人你的退出意向,给他们留出调整的时间。
- 可以通过电子邮件或项目内的沟通工具进行通知。
3. 移除自己的分支
如果你在项目中有自己的分支,可以选择将其合并到主分支(如果有必要),或者直接删除。
如何删除分支:
- 在项目的GitHub页面,切换到“Branches”标签。
- 找到你的分支,点击右侧的“Delete”按钮。
4. 退出项目的Collaborator
- 如果你是该项目的协作者,可以通过以下步骤退出:
- 访问项目的主页。
- 点击“Settings”选项。
- 在“Manage access”中,选择“Remove”你的协作权限。
5. 关闭问题和PR
- 如果你有未完成的问题或合并请求,最好将其关闭,以免造成困扰。
四、退出项目后的处理
退出项目后,你仍然可以保持对项目的关注。
1. 监控项目更新
- 可以选择不再作为协作者,但仍可以通过Star来关注项目。
2. 回顾自己的贡献
- 不妨回顾一下自己在项目中的贡献,并考虑未来的学习和发展。
3. 保持良好的关系
- 尽量与项目团队保持友好的关系,以便未来有可能的合作机会。
五、常见问题解答(FAQ)
1. 如何知道自己是否真的退出了项目?
- 退出后,可以查看你的GitHub通知,如果没有收到该项目的通知,通常说明你已经退出。
2. 退出项目会影响我的GitHub账户吗?
- 退出项目不会影响你的GitHub账户,只是你不再是该项目的参与者。
3. 如何重新加入已退出的项目?
- 如果希望重新加入项目,可以联系项目负责人请求恢复协作者权限。
4. 退出项目后能否继续查看代码?
- 是的,任何人都可以查看公共项目的代码,即使退出后。
5. 有哪些退出项目的注意事项?
- 保持透明与团队沟通,确保项目团队能够适时调整。
- 处理好个人的分支与未解决的问题。
六、总结
在GitHub上退出项目并不意味着你与项目的联系完全断绝,而是出于个人发展和管理需要做出的明智决定。遵循以上步骤,可以帮助你顺利退出项目,保持良好的职业道德。希望本文能够帮助到需要退出GitHub项目的开发者们,祝你在今后的开发旅程中顺利前行!
正文完